Sammarinese politician (1944–2019)


Marino Venturini (23 March 1944 – 5 June 2019) was a Sammarinese politician who served as captain regent on four occasions. He was a member of the Sammarinese Socialist Party.[2]

Biography

His first term was with Clelio Galassi (April 1976-October 1976). His second term was with Giuseppe Maiani from (April 1982-October 1982). His third term was with Ariosto Maiani from April 1986 to October 1986. His fourth term was with Piere Natalino Mularoni (October 1995-April 1996).

In 1982 he, alongside Giuseppe Maiani, welcomed Pope John Paul II when the head of the Catholic Church arrived for a historic visit in San Marino.[3]

Marino Venturini died on 5 June 2019 in the state hospital of San Marino.[4]
